CA-702 (Effective-Mononuclear Cell, E-MNC) is an autologous cell therapy product being developed for the treatment of radiation-induced xerostomia (dry mouth) following radiotherapy for head and neck cancer. The therapy is derived from a patient's peripheral blood mononuclear cells (PBMCs) that have been processed using a specialized "Quality and Quantity" (Q&Q) culture system. This culture method enriches the cell population for vasculogenic and anti-inflammatory cells, including endothelial progenitor cells (EPCs) and M2-like macrophages. When administered via local injection into damaged salivary glands, CA-702 is intended to promote angiogenesis, reduce chronic inflammation, and stimulate the regeneration of salivary gland tissue, thereby restoring salivary secretion and improving patient quality of life.
